NEW ORLEANS — Patients with diabetes who have not been diagnosed with atherosclerotic cardiovascular disease would benefit by taking the PCSK9 inhibitor evolocumab to lower their LDL cholesterol to levels significantly below what existing clinical guidelines call for, a subgroup analysis of the VESALIUS-CV clinical trial has found.
Patients in the original study taking evolocumab, sold as Repatha by Amgen, achieved an average LDL-C of 44 mg/dL at 96 weeks vs 105 mg/dL for the placebo group and maintained that level out to at least 5 years. That reduction in cholesterol was associated with a 31% reduction in major adverse cardiovascular events (MACE), the researchers reported.
“This subgroup analysis in particular is practice-changing because we currently are using evolocumab in patients with high-risk atherosclerosis, so this group with unknown atherosclerosis is really a novel group,” Nicholas Marston, MD, MPH, a cardiologist at Brigham and Women’s Hospital and Harvard Medical School in Boston told Medscape Medical News.
Marston presented results from the VESALIUS-CV subgroup analysis here at the 2026 annual meeting of the American College of Cardiology. The results have been published simultaneously in JAMA.
The subgroup analysis included 3655 patients representing 30% of the total population of VESALIUS-CV, the results of which were presented last fall at the 2025 annual meeting of the American Heart Association. The patients had high-risk diabetes, defined as disease duration for at least 10 years, taking daily insulin, or having microvascular disease. Participants also had no known significant atherosclerosis, including no known coronary artery calcium score of 100 Agatston units or greater. Women represented 57% of the group and 93% were White. The average LDL-C on enrollment was 132 mg/dL.
Lipid-Lowering, MACE Outcomes
Patients taking evolocumab achieved an average LDL-C of 44 mg/dL at 96 weeks vs 105 mg/dL for the placebo group, Marston said. The treatment group maintained that level out to 5 years.
Patients taking evolocumab experienced a 31% relative risk reduction at 5 years in three-point MACE — defined as coronary heart death, myocardial infarction, or ischemic stroke — with rates of 5% for the drug and 7.1% for placebo (P = .009).
For a four-point MACE outcome, which included ischemia-driven revascularization, the 5-year rates were 7.6% and 10.5% for the respective groups, Marston said, matching the 31% relative risk reduction for three-point MACE with evolocumab.
Mortality rates also varied significantly, Marston said. Rates of cardiovascular death were 2.6% and 4% in the evolocumab and placebo groups, while those for all-cause mortality were 7.8% and 10.1%, respectively.
“The benefits seen in this subgroup support intensification of lipid-lowering therapy beyond statins earlier in the atherosclerotic cardiovascular disease process,” Marston told attendees.
The analysis included a Cholesterol Treatment Trialists’ Collaboration meta-regression that determined lowering cholesterol in the study population led to reduced cardiovascular events, Marston said.
“This underscores the value of lower LDL cholesterol down to around 40 mg/dL in these patients,” he said. "Thus, these data strongly support that in these lower-risk patients, we should be targeting LDL cholesterol goals typically reserved for very high-risk secondary prevention patients.”
“I do think it’s practice-changing,” John Bucheit, PharmD, of the Virginia Commonwealth University School of Pharmacy in Richmond, told Medscape Medical News of the new analysis.
The evidence would have been strong enough for inclusion in the latest updated clinical practice guidelines on dyslipidemia management from the American Heart Association and the American College of Cardiology, Bucheit said, but the study’s timing 2 weeks after the guidelines appeared did not work out.
"Now we have additional analysis that’s really impactful,” he said.
“We all see these high-risk patients with diabetes in the clinic, but it has been an evidence-based gap,” Bucheit added. “The trial and the subgroup analysis really helps us get there.
"This trial to me reinforces that lower is better. As we go forward, we have to look at our high-risk primary prevention patients and really think about reexamining targets.”
The next key step would involve obtaining insurance coverage for PCSK9 inhibitors for these patients, Bucheit added.
